I got up at 4:00 am and caught the bus to the starting line. I started the race running with the 4:15 pace guy. That was good until about mile 11. I had to stop to use the bathroom. I caught back up about a mile later, but then it started getting hot, and I was having problems. At mile 17 I started having spasms in my right leg. I was thinking about dropping out at mile 18. I decided to go until at least 20. I called my wife to tell her I needed spasm medication. After i got to mile 20 I decided it was just 6 more miles, and continued on. My son meet me at mile 22.5 with medication, then he ran a 1/2 mile with me. It was the hardest race I have ever run because of the heat, and heat and MS don't get along. It took almost 5.5 hour to finish, but I kept going, and finished. I almost fell over after I finished I sat in the shade for 5 minutes. I think my legs were saying I took you 26.2 miles mow I am done.
